Oknoname 093002

TR-EAGLE CHIEF CREEK· Major, Oklahoma· Built 1938· Earth· 40 ft tall
Low Hazard Other Private

Key Takeaway

Oknoname 093002 is classified as low hazard in Oklahoma. It was completed in 1938 and is 88 years old. Its primary use is other.

Physical Details

Dam Height 40 ft (taller than 83.4% in OK)
Dam Length476 ft
Dam TypeEarth
Max Storage90 acre-ft
Normal Storage45 acre-ft
Surface Area8 acres
Max Discharge7,372 cfs
Year Completed1938 (88 years old)
NID IDOK12535

Safety Information

Low Hazard

No probable loss of human life and low economic/environmental losses expected.

Hazard potential describes downstream consequences of failure, not the dam's current condition. What does this mean?

Emergency Action Plan: No
Last Inspection: November 30, 2010
State Regulated: Yes
Regulatory Agency: OWRB
